Lyst is a global fashion shopping platform founded in London in 2010, serving over 160 million shoppers annually. We offer a vast assortment of premium and luxury fashion products from 27,000 brands and stores. In 2025, Lyst joined Zozo, Japan's leading fashion e-commerce platform, marking a new era for our company as we focus on AI and technology to transform fashion shopping.
